Track listing
No. | Title | Length |
---|---|---|
1. | "Hey Fellas" (Emmett Nixon/Robert Reed/Tony Fisher) | 7:18 |
2. | "Get On Up" (Emmett Nixon/Robert Reed) | 4:50 |
3. | "Let's Get Hot" (Emmett Nixon/Robert Reed) | 4:38 |
4. | "Drop the Bomb" (Chester Davis/Emmett Nixon/James Avery/Robert Reed/Taylor Reed/Timothy Davis/Tony Fisher) | 6:58 |
5. | "Pump Me Up" (Emmett Nixon/Robert Reed/Taylor Reed/Tony Fisher) | 6:34 |
6. | "Don't Try to Use Me" (Robert Reed/Tony Fisher) | 6:15 |
Total length: | 36:43 |
Personnel
- Chester "T-Bone" Davis — electric guitar
- Tony Fisher — lead vocals, bass guitar
- Emmett Nixon — drums
- James Avery — keyboards
- Robert Reed — keyboards
- Mack Carey — percussion, congas
- Timothy "T-Bone" David – percussion, vocals
- David Rudd — saxophone
- Gerald Reed — trombone
- Taylor Reed — trombone, trumpet
